Rules For Handling Water Damage
Water offers life, yet water invasion on some parts where it's not intended to be can cause damage and aggravation. It can peel away the surface and wear down the product's foundation if the water leaks right into your structure. Mold and mildew as well as mildew likewise prosper in a damp setting, which can be hazardous for your as well as your family members's health. Furthermore, residences with water damage scent old as well as mildewy.

Water can come from many resources like hurricanes, floodings, ruptured pipelines, leakages, and sewage system problems. If you have water damage, it's much better to have a working expertise of safety and security preventative measures. Below are a couple of guidelines on just how to deal with water damages.

Do Prioritize Residence Insurance Insurance Coverage



Seasonal water damages can originate from floods, seasonal rains, and wind. There is additionally an incident of an abrupt flooding, whether it originated from a defective pipeline that unexpectedly breaks into your residence. To safeguard your house, obtain house insurance that covers both acts of God such as all-natural disasters, and also emergency situations like damaged plumbing.

Do Not Forget to Turn Off Energies



When disaster strikes and also you remain in a flood-prone area, shut off the major electrical circuit. Shutting off the power avoids
electric shocks when water is available in as water acts as a conductor. Don't forget to switch off the major water line shutoff as a method to avoid even more damages.
Maintain your furniture steady as they can move about as well as cause added damages if the floodwaters are obtaining high.

Do Remain Proactive as well as Heed Climate Informs



If you live in a location pestered by floods, remain ready and aggressive at all times. Listen to the news as well as evacuation warnings if you live near a body of water like a creek, lake, or river .

Don't Ignore the Roof



Your roofing professional ought to take care of the faulty gutters or any type of other indications of damage or weakening. An assessment will certainly avoid water from moving down your wall surfaces and also soaking your ceiling.

Do Focus On Tiny Leaks



There are red flags that can attract your interest and suggest to you some damaged pipelines in your residence. Indications of red flags in your pipelines include gurgling paint, peeling off wallpaper, water touches, water discolorations, or dripping sounds behind the wall surfaces. Repair and also evaluate your plumbing repaired before it results in huge damage to your residence, finances, and an individual headache.

Do Not Panic in Case of a Ruptured Pipe



Maintaining your presence of mind is crucial in a time of situation. Worrying will just worsen the problem due to the fact that it will stifle you from acting fast. Panic will likewise offer you extra stress. When it comes to water damages, timing is key. The longer you wait, the more damage you can expect and the worst the outcomes can be. Instantly shut off your main water valve to cut off the resource and protect against more damages if a pipe bursts in your residence. Disconnect all electrical outlets in the location or shut off the circuit breaker for that part of the house. Call a trusted water damage repair specialist for help.

Water Damage Do and Don'ts


Water damage at your home or commercial property is a serious problem. You will need assistance from a professional plumber and a water damage restoration agency to get things back in order. While you are waiting for help to arrive, however, there are some things you should do to make the situation better. Likewise, there are things you absolutely shoud not do because they will only make things worse.




DO these things to improve your situation


Get some ventilation going. Open up your doors, your windows, your cabinets – everything. Don’t let anything remain closed. Your aim here is to expose as much surface area to air as possible in order to quicken the drying out process. Use fans if you have them, but only if they’re plugged into a part of the house that’s not currently underwater.


Remove as much standing water as you can. Do this by using mops, sponges and clean white towels. However, it’s important that you don’t push or wipe the water. Simply use blotting motions to soak it up. Wiping or pushing could result in the water getting pushed deeper into your home or carpeting and increasing your problem.


Turn off the power to the soaked areas. You will want to remove the danger of electrocution from the water-logged area to do some cleaning and to help the plumber and the restoration agents do their work.



Move any furniture and belongings from the affected room to a safe and dry area. Taking your possessions to a dry place will make it easier to decide which need restoring and repair. It will also prevent your belongings from being exposed to further moisture.


DON’T do any of these things for any reason


Don’t use your vacuum cleaner to suck up the water. This will not only get you electrocuted, but will also severely damage your vacuum cleaner. Use manual means of water removal, like with mops and pails.



Don’t use newspaper to soak up the water. The ink they use for newsprint runs and transfers very easily, which could then stain carpet and tile with hard-to-remove stains.



Don’t disturb mold. This is especially true if you spot a severe growth. Leave the mold remediation efforts to the professionals. Attempting to clean it yourself could mean exposing yourself to the harmful health effects of mold. Worse, you could inadvertently spread it to other areas of the house.



Don’t turn on your HVAC system until given approval from the restoration agency. Turning your HVAC system on before everything has been cleaned could spread moisture and mold all over the house.
